Wales is a kintra in north-wast Europe. It is ane o the sax Celtic kintras an ane o the fower muckle pairts o the Unitit Kinrick. The laund is in the sooth-wast o Graet Breetain an haes til its aest the laund o Ingland, an is bund bi sea on its ither sides.

The laund o Wales wis taen ower bi Ingland in the 13t century an makkit part o the Kinrick o Ingland bi the Act o Union 1536. In 1997 the Welsh fowk voted tae hae a new pairlament, which wis estaiblisht in 1999 an haes the pouer to govern the laund o Wales on hits ain maiters only.

The Welsh leid (Cymraeg) is ane o the Brythonic brainch o the Celtic leids an is sib til Cornish an Breton. It is spak by aroun 20% o the fowk o Wales.
